I am actually kinda' new to the .300WM. I ended up with a "project gun" that someone started. It is a single shot target rifle based upon a U.S. Enfield action with a Pattern 14 bolt and a comercial barrel all in a heavy target stock.

I should say it now has a Pattern 14 bolt as when I got it the "original" bolt was in place but looked like it had been buried for many years. Unlike the very clean action the bolt was so badly pitted there was no smooth surface anywhere. Also the bolt face was not opened up for the magnum case.

Once the P14 bolt body was fitted, I dropped the old "no-go" gage in and the bolt wouldn't even think of dropping. Put in a "go" and it just closes.

Anyway, my intention is to finish the build as an "any sight" gun for 600 and 1000 yard matches.
